A tall, condensed handwritten print with monoline strokes and softly rounded terminals. Letterforms lean toward simple, single-stroke construction with occasional gentle hooks and asymmetries that keep the rhythm lively. Curves are narrow and vertical, counters are compact, and spacing is even enough for text while still retaining an organic, drawn-in-ink feel. Capitals are slim and airy; lowercase maintains a steady x-height with distinctive, slightly irregular bowls and stems, and the numerals follow the same narrow, upright structure.
Well suited for packaging, labels, posters, and short headlines where a friendly handwritten voice is desired. It also works for playful branding elements and social graphics, particularly when a narrow footprint is helpful for fitting more characters into limited space.
The overall tone is approachable and upbeat, like neat marker or pen lettering used for labels and casual notes. Its narrow, tall shapes and subtle irregularities give it a quirky, handmade personality without becoming messy or overly expressive.
The font appears intended to deliver a clean, legible handwritten print style with a compact, vertical silhouette. It balances consistency with small human imperfections to communicate warmth and informality while staying readable in short to medium passages.
The design favors straight vertical stems and tight curves, producing a compact texture in paragraphs. Rounded joins and blunt, softened ends help maintain clarity at display sizes, while the hand-drawn inconsistencies add charm and keep repeated letters from feeling mechanical.
